Hounslow's e-bike scheme marks one year with over a million trips taken
8 August 2026 · By Boroughly editorial — AI-assisted, human-reviewed.
The Forest and Voi e-bike hire service has completed its first full year operating across Hounslow, and the borough is marking the occasion with exclusive ride discounts for users. Since the scheme launched, residents have collectively taken more than one million trips on the docked and dockless bikes — a figure Hounslow Council is highlighting as evidence of a shift towards greener short-distance travel. For Chiswick residents, both Forest and Voi bikes are available to hire across parts of W4 and the wider borough, making them a practical option for short hops to Chiswick High Road, the station or the riverside. The bikes can be located and unlocked via the respective apps. With today's warm weather and the fine spell expected to continue all week, it is a good time to try the scheme if you have not already.
